Subject: Handover — AdminDesk dark mode release

Hey Priya,

Taking off for the week, so here's where things stand. Dark mode for the Fennmark admin dashboard is feature-flagged and ready; rollout is scheduled for Thursday. Watch for contrast complaints on the audit tables — known quirk. If you need to push a hotfix, the build pipeline will ask you to sign the artifact. Here's the release signing key:

rollout seal: bky4_x7Gc

**Ticket: Config drift on BounceSift processor**

The email bounce processor in the Larkfield environment has drifted from the values committed in the release branch. Retry windows and suppression thresholds no longer match, which likely explains the duplicate suppression entries reported Tuesday. Please reconcile before the Thursday cut. For reference, the currently deployed configuration on the live node reads as follows.

config for yajep-yahof:
[briax]
port = 9200
region = outer-2
host = briax.nelvrocorp.test
team = raleth
timeout_ms = 1500
retries = 1

Action item from the Mirewater tide-table widget incident. Owner: release manager. Widget cached stale harbor offsets after the DST change, showing tides six hours off for two days. Required: add a cache-invalidation check to the release checklist, block deploys when offset tables are older than 24 hours, and verify the Saltgate harbor feed before each cut. Deadline: next release. Checklist template and sign-off procedure are documented on the internal page below.

wiki page, kawif-bajep: https://artifactory.zarqelforge.internal/issue/browse/display/display/projects/spaces/secrets/000fe6ec5a46af29355003e1